Rear Window is a 1954 American mystery thriller film directed by Alfred Hitchcock and written by John Michael Hayes based on Cornell Woolrichs 1942 short story It Had to Be Murder. This is indicated to us by a follow up shot of Thornwalds seemingly empty home. Originally released by Paramount Pictures the film stars James Stewart Grace Kelly Wendell Corey Thelma Ritter and Raymond BurrIt was screened at the 1954 Venice Film Festival. Both stories follow a house-locked man who spies on his neighbors and thinks he witnesses one of them murdering his wife.
